What is a food chain Class 6?

A food chain is a sequence that shows how each living organism gets its food in a particular environment. Example: Plants’grasshopper ‘shrew ‘owl. In the food chain shown, plants prepare food from sunlight, using carbon dioxide from the air by the process of photosynthesis.

Why are there only 4/5 trophic levels in food chains?

There is only 10% flow of energy from one trophic level to the next higher level. The loss of energy at each step is so great that very little usable remains after four or five trophic levels. Hence only 4 to 5 trophic levels are present in each food chain.

Why do food chains have 3 to 4 trophic levels?

A food chain’s length is restricted to just 3 or 4 steps due to energy loss. Moreover, the energy added to the biomass of each trophic level is significantly lower than the one preceding it. Consequently, the shorter the food chain, the more energy that is available to the final consumer.

Why are trophic levels limited?

In a food chain, only 10% of the total amount of energy is passed on to the next trophic level from the previous trophic level. As we move higher up in the food chain the amount of energy diminishes to a level at which it cannot sustain any trophic level, thereby limiting the number of trophic levels.
